Hong Kong Football Club Soccer/Rugby Pitch

Hong Kong Football Club Stadium (Chinese: 香港足球會球場) is a multi-purpose stadium located in Sports Rd, Happy Valley, Hong Kong. The main pitch is used for football and rugby (union) matches, and there is an adjoining hockey pitch. The playing surface has been synthetic since 2004.

The stadium (which is owned by the Hong Kong Football Club) holds 2,750 people, and hosts the annual Hong Kong Tens tournament and the HKFC International Soccer Sevens tournament.

Sports Road was the venue for the world famous Hong Kong Sevens from its inception in 1976 till it outgrew its home and was moved to the Hong Kong Government Stadium (now the Hong Kong Stadium) in 1982.
